This is Crackers, our peach-face lovebird. Wondering what might be going =
on here with his back.

Mites? Boredom (he does get attention every day)? Stress? Rash? =
Nutrition? Natural moulting? Unusual moulting?

We've: supplemented his diet with plumage enhancing drops; installed a =
bird protector for mites; given him more attention (even though he gets =
a bit ornery sometimes).

He's otherwise healthy and active.

We've had him for more than 4.5 years and this came on over a period of =
months. Didn't know what to think as he has been living as is during =
that time.
